A hernia occurs when an organ or tissue protrudes through a weak spot in a muscle or fascia, often in the abdomen. This can cause pain, discomfort, and in some cases, complications such as bowel obstruction. Hernias are typically caused by a combination of factors, including weakened muscles, increased pressure on the abdomen, and genetic predisposition. Common types of hernias include inguinal hernias, femoral hernias, umbilical hernias, and hiatal hernias. Treatment for hernias often depends on the severity of the condition and the patient's symptoms. In mild cases, observation and pain management may be sufficient. However, more severe cases may require surgical intervention to repair the hernia and prevent complications. Surgery can be performed using open techniques or laparoscopic techniques, which involve smaller incisions and less recovery time.
